What temperature should a solar panel be at?

According to the manufacture standards, 25 °C or 77 °F temperature indicates the peak of the optimum temperature range of photovoltaic solar panels. It is when solar photovoltaic cells are able to absorb sunlight with maximum efficiency and when we can expect them to perform the best. The solar panel output fluctuates in real life conditions.

How does temperature affect the efficiency of a PV panel?

As the temperature of a PV panel increases above 25°C (77°F), its efficiency tends to decrease due to the temperature coefficient. The coefficient measures how much the output power decreases for every degree Celsius above a reference temperature (usually 25°C).

What temperature should solar panels be in a heat wave?

The optimal temperature for solar panels is around 25°C (77°F). Solar panels perform best under moderate temperatures, as higher or lower temperatures can reduce efficiency. For every degree above 25°C, a solar panel’s output can decrease by around 0.3% to 0.5%, affecting overall energy production. Why Don’t Solar Panels Work as Well in Heat Waves?

Does temperature affect the efficiency of PV panels mounted on automobiles?

Tiano et al. developed a model capable of estimating the temperature effect of PV panels mounted on automobiles under real meteorological conditions. Through model testing, it was found that the increase in the temperature of the PV panel during the parking phase resulted in a significant decrease in its efficiency.
